Overall Meaning

Believer's song "Vile Hypocrisy" is a powerful condemnation of the hypocrisy that exists within organized religion. The lyrics discuss the way that religious leaders often place their own desires and interests above the needs of their followers, leading people astray and causing them to fall victim to deception and wickedness. The song opens with accusations of "worthless idols," a warning about the dangers of following false gods and prophets who are not ordained by the Father. The lyrics go on to describe the way that religious leaders often place too much emphasis on legalistic actions, ignoring the real needs of their followers in favor of maintaining a false veneer of virtue.


The chorus of the song is particularly powerful, drawing attention to the way that hypocrisy can lead people to deny God by their deeds while still claiming intimacy with Him. The song argues that true faith requires more than just following a set of external rules and regulations--it requires an inner commitment to love and compassion. The song ends with a warning about the eternal consequences of rejecting Christ and a call to resist deceitful guidance and stay true to the teachings of the Bible.
